Yes that's a magnificent stretch of road. The summit is at 2757m and it's the 2nd highest mountain pass in the Alps.
I climbed it on a bicycle in 1998 on a tour going from Copenhagen to Milano. Many of the hairpin turns are signposted with their number and elevation so you get the full 'joy' of knowing how many you've got left before the summit... (I suppose that doesn't have quite the same impact when you're sitting comfortably on a motorbike)
